The Law Society of England and Wales tried to address some of these problems by changing the mandatory «minimum terms and conditions» (or MTC) that insurers must abide by and also tried to reintroduce a master policy that would ensure all members of the bar were insured on equal terms (similar to the LAWPRO single policy which is issued to the Law Society of Upper Canada and insures individual lawyer - licensees and qualifying non-lawyer partners, as specified in its terms).
